POPULATION, EMPLOYMENT, AND INCOME


 
                                         State       Metro      Nonmetro
 Population
     1980                              4,075,970    2,673,915     1,402,055
     1990                              4,375,665    3,011,460     1,364,205
     Latest(1997)                      4,685,549    3,273,587     1,411,962
 
 Per-capita income (1996 dollars)
     1995                                 24,673       27,146        19,010
     1996                                 25,699       28,098        20,178
 Change                                      4.2%         3.5%          6.1%
 
 Earnings per job (1996 dollars)
     1995                                 27,823       30,651        20,131
     1996                                 28,816       31,495        21,519
 Change                                      3.6%         2.8%          6.9%
 
 Poverty rate
     1980                                    9.5          7.4          13.4
     1990                                   10.2          8.8          13.3
     Latest(1995-96)                         9.5           N/A           N/A
 
 Total Number of Jobs
     1995                              3,026,213    2,212,650       813,563
     1996                              3,083,687    2,255,514       828,173
 
 Unemployment Rate
     1996                                    4.0          3.4           5.6
     1997                                    3.3          2.7           4.7
 
 Percent employment change
     1994-95                                 1.4          1.7           0.6
     1995-96                                -0.0         -0.1           0.2
     1996-97                                 1.5          1.8           0.8
 
 Percent of 1995 employment in farm and farm related jobs:
 
  Total                                     16.0         12.2          26.4
     Production                              3.9          1.4          10.8
     Farm Inputs                             0.6          0.3           1.5
     Proc. & Mark.                           1.9          1.1           4.0
     Whol.& Retail                           9.2          9.0           9.7
 


FARM CHARACTERISTICS


                           1992 Census of Agriculture
 
TOTAL LAND AREA (million acres)                                        51.0
   TOTAL FARMLAND (million acres)                                      25.7
      of total land area                                               50.4%
 
      CROPLAND (million acres)                                         21.4
         of total farmland                                             83.3%
            irrigated                                                   1.7%
            in pasture                                                  4.9%
            in Fed. farm program                                        2.0%
            in Conservation Reserve                                     4.2%
 
      WOODLAND (million acres)                                          1.9
         of total farmland                                              7.6%
            in pasture                                                 41.8%
 
      PASTURELAND (million acres)                                       1.0
         of total farmland                                              3.8%
 
      OTHER LAND (million acres)                                        1.4
         of total farmland                                              5.3%
 
AVERAGE FARM SIZE (acres)                                             342.0
 
FARMS BY SIZE
        1 to 99 acres                                                  27.4%
 
        100 to 499 acres                                               52.3%
 
        500 to 999 acres                                               14.0%
 
        1,000 to 1,999 acres                                            5.2%
 
        2,000 or more acres                                             1.2%
 
FARMS BY SALES
        Less than $50,000                                              57.9%
 
        $50,000 to $99,999                                             16.6%
 
        $100,000 to $499,999                                           23.7%
 
        More than $500,000                                              1.8%
 
TENURE OF FARMERS
     Full owner (farms)                                              38,301
        Percent of total                                               51.0%
 
     Part owner (farms)                                              28,364
        Percent of total                                               37.8%
 
     Tenant (farms)                                                   8,414
        Percent of total                                               11.2%
 
FARM ORGANIZATION
     Individuals/family corporations (farms)                         67,888
        Percent of total                                               90.4%
 
     Partnerships (farms)                                             6,800
        Percent of total                                                9.1%
 
     Non-family corporations (farms)                                    162
        Percent of total                                                0.2%
 
     Others (farms)                                                     229
        Percent of total                                                0.3%
 
Avg. Operator Age (yrs.)                                                 50
Perc. w/ farming as their                                              68.0%
     principal occupation

FARM FINANCIAL INDICATORS


 
Farm Income and Balance Sheet Statement
                    Year                                1995         1996
Number of farms                                        87,000        87,000
 
                                                           Million $
  Final crop output                                   3,715.8       4,756.5
+ Final animal output                                 3,534.7       4,086.6
+ Services and forestry                                 667.8         708.1
= Final agricultural sector output                    7,918.3       9,551.3
 
- Intermediate consumption outlays                    4,699.7       4,821.9
+ Net government transactions                           142.8          21.3
= Gross value added                                   3,361.4       4,750.8
 
- Capital consumption                                   985.7         981.9
 
= NET VALUE ADDED                                     2,375.7       3,768.9
 
- Factor payments                                     1,317.7       1,526.0
    Employee compensation (total hired labor)           334.8         387.7
    Net rent received by nonoperator landlords          313.2         442.3
    Real estate and nonreal estate interest             669.8         696.0
 
= NET FARM INCOME                                     1,058.0       2,242.9

 
Farm Balance Sheet as of December 31:                    1995          1996
 
FARM ASSETS                                          38,025.5      39,731.1
     Real estate                                     25,246.1      26,901.6
     Nonreal estate                                  12,779.4      12,829.6
 
FARM DEBT                                             7,707.0       8,104.2
     Real estate                                      3,890.7       4,017.1
     Nonreal estate                                   3,816.3       4,087.1
 
       EQUITY                                        30,318.5      31,626.9
 
 RATIOS                                                          Percent
     Debt/equity                                         25.4          25.6
     Debt/assets                                         20.3          20.4

 
 TOP 5 AGRICULTURE COMMODITIES, 1996
 
                                              % of State Tot.      % of US
Commodity                                     Farm Receipts        Tot.Val.
 
 1.   Corn                                               19.3           7.9
 2.   Soybean                                            18.3           9.9
 3.   Dairy products                                     15.4           5.9
 4.   Hogs                                               12.6           8.8
 5.   Cattle and calves                                  10.5           2.9
 
                                     All Commodities                    4.4
 
 
 TOP 5 AGRICULTURE EXPORTS, ESTIMATES, FY 1997
                                                     Rank Among
                                                       States       Value
  Commodity
                                                                   Million $
 1.   Soybeans and products                                 3         870.8
 2.   Feed grains and products                              4         783.5
 3.   Live animals and meat exc. poultry                    7         202.9
 4.   Vegetables and preps.                                 5         168.6
 5.   Wheat and products                                   16         120.9
 
                                     Overall                7       2,610.5
 
 
 TOP 5 COUNTIES IN AGRICULTURAL SALES 1992
 
                                              Percent of State's
                                              Total Receipts       Million $
 
 1.   STEARNS                                             4.2%        269.0
 2.   POLK                                                3.0%        196.8
 3.   RENVILLE                                            2.9%        188.8
 4.   KANDIYOHI                                           2.9%        186.2
 5.   OTTER TAIL                                          2.6%        170.7
 
                                     State Total                    6,477.0
